Like I said, this has happened before in other threads. The lucas goop sinks right to the bottom of the pan and can;t get sucked into the filter. I'm guessing that this is because it was poured in with the engine off so instead of mixing it all just sat at the bottom.

ATF is cheap, and if I'm right it will save you a lot of time and money. Change the fluid and filter, add some trans-x and see what happens. If your tranny starts working again we can trouble shoot your flaring issue next.
